6 uuid = "c4f5ad74-2d9a-4a17-9633-3e9e49d5f773";
8 packet.header := struct {
9 integer { size = 32;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} magic;
10 integer { size = 8;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} uuid[16];
11 integer { size = 32;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} stream_id;
12 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} stream_instance_id;
19 tracer_name = "lttng-ust";
26 uuid = "00000000-0000-0000-0000-000000000000";
27 description = "Monotonic Clock";
31 offset = 1497619475540462738;
37 event.header := struct {
38 enum : integer { size = 5; align = 1; signed = false; encoding = none; base = decimal; byte_order = le; } { "compact" = 0 ... 30, "extended" = 31 } id;
41 integer { size = 64; align = 1; signed = false; encoding = none; base = decimal; byte_order = le; map = clock.monotonic.value; } timestamp;
44 integer { size = 32;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} id;
45 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; map = clock.monotonic.value; } timestamp;
50 packet.context := struct {
51 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; map = clock.monotonic.value; } timestamp_begin;
52 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; map = clock.monotonic.value; } timestamp_end;
53 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} content_size;
54 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} packet_size;
55 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} packet_seq_num;
56 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} events_discarded;
57 integer { size = 32;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} cpu_id;
60 event.context := struct {
61 integer { size = 32; align = 8; signed = true; encoding = none; base = decimal; byte_order = le; } _vpid;
62 integer { size = 64; align = 8; signed = false; encoding = none; base = hexadecimal; byte_order = le; } _ip;
67 name = "lttng_ust_statedump:bin_info";
72 integer { size = 64; align = 8; signed = false; encoding = none; base = hexadecimal; byte_order = le; } _baddr;
73 integer { size = 64;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} _memsz;
74 string { encoding = UTF8; } _path;
75 integer { size = 8;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} _is_pic;
76 integer { size = 8;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} _has_build_id;
77 integer { size = 8; align = 8; signed = false; encoding = none; base = decimal; byte_order = le; } _has_debug_link;
82 name = "my_provider:my_first_tracepoint";
87 string { encoding = UTF8; } _my_string_field;
88 integer { size = 32; align = 8; signed = true; encoding = none; base = decimal; byte_order = le; } _my_integer_field;